Description: The Computational Biology Initiative (CBI) is a new interdisciplinary initiative at the University of Texas Health Science Center at San Antonio (UTHSCSA) and the University of Texas at San Antonio (UTSA) which was launched in January 2005. The overall goal of the initiative is to build infrastructure to significantly advance collaborative interdisciplinary bioscience research in San Antonio. Currently, healthcare and biotechnology industries lead the San Antonio economy with an estimated annual economic impact of over $13 billion and employ almost 100,000 citizens. The San Antonio area is developing a burgeoning biotechnology base. The objectives of this program are to foster the use of state-of-the-art core computational and analytic facilities, to enhance local expertise in San Antonio bioscience community, and to develop training opportunities.

Description: Established in 2005 and housed at the University of Texas at San Antonio (UTSA), the Society for the Study of Gloria Anzaldúa (SSGA) provides a place for scholars, students, and community to come together with the intention of engaging in the continued study of intellectual and spiritual work of Chicana feminist Gloria Evangelina Anzaldúa.The SSGA is the brainchild of Dr. Norma Cantu, award-winning author and professor of English and U.S. Latina/o Literature at UTSA. Her works include Papeles de mujer (novel), Champu: or Hair Matters (novel), and Meditacion Fronteriza: Poems of Life, Love and Work (poetry).
